I have a Nice 8.7 which works smoothly on a Win NT m/c but doesn't on a Win 2K m/c. The CPU utilisation shoots to 100% for those m/c's with Win 2k whenever I install Nice screenagent.This problem is only for screenagent on Win 2k machines.

Any idea?

Hi Robonix,

Sounds very similar to a problem that we are facing while testing a Windows 2000 rollout to client machines... this is to do with the Screen Agent software that you are using.

If you look in NT's task manager, you SHOULD see a program called NTRec.exe, this is the screen agent software which is ONLY designed to run on Windows NT.

In order for screen agent to work under Windows 2000, the software must be upgraded to Screen Agent v8.5.5. Not sure how big your organisation / site is etc, but we have a Global Agreement with NICE as we have 57 centres round the world and they want to charge us USD $25,000 for this upgrade... just for the UK !!!
